The Importance Of Breakfast:Fact Or Fiction

Breakfast has long been pointed to by many as being the most important meal of the day. But is this just a myth passed down through the ages, or is there actual scientific verification for the statement that breakfast is important.

To understand more about this subject, it is good to realise what breakfast actually is. Breakfast is the meal which ‘breaks the fast’ which the body has experienced over night. A fast is a time when we give our body a rest from eating. In some cultures, people fast regulary to be sure that their bodies get a break, but night time (and sleeping) are the natural times for the body to do this. It’s not something that we have to build into our lifestyle! The first meal after that sleeping is usually, then, a meal which is taken fairly early in the morning and before we begin our day’s activities. It sets the scene for the body of what it is now expected to do. It kick starts, if you like, the metabolism. It signals the body to get ready for a new day.

Many people skip breakfast because they feel that they don’t have time for breakfast. But to break the fast after a night’s sleep does not require a meal which has taken hours to prepare. A simple bowl of cereal with a splash of milk will suffice. And the time saved in not eating it is not worth the loss that will be suffered.

What loss, I hear you ask! Let us look at the loss of energy. Without breakfast, we expect our rested body to begin a day’s activities with no nourishment since the night before. Therefore, later in the day there will be a corresponding loss of energy as the body’s blood/sugar level drops. It may be necessary to eat some high calorie food from a vending machine you are passing so that your body can continue to operate effectively. So, the next loss we might expect is a loss of appetite for the next proper meal that we would normally have, lunch.

As you may see, there is a cycle being established. If you begin your day with a nourishing and satisfying breakfast, you will be less likely to eat between meals and, in particular, to be drawn to high calorie, high sugar foods for energy. Which leads to another reason that people often give for not eating breakfast. They think that by not eating breakfast they will be able to lose weight. In fact, studies show that people with high BMI (body mass index) are people who tend to skip breakfast. Obese people are often those who eat high calorie food at nighttime, when there is not an opportunity for the body to burn the calories as the body is preparing to rest for the night. Participants of the Seasonal Variation of Blood Cholesterol Study (SEASONS), for example, who regularly skipped breakfast, had 4.5 times the risk of obesity as those who consumed breakfast regularly! But while the link between obesity and skipping breakfast is strong, there is room to subscribe also to the notion that people who don’t east breakfast also make other decisions which are not nutritionally astute and thus contribute to their obesity.

The fact is, though, that the body and brain expect to be re-fuelled a few times a day at intervals which are appropriate to what the body has been doing. So, it may be that if a person’s occupation has them physically very busy in the morning, they may eat breakfast and follow fairly quickly with another snack prior to lunch and then may not need additional ‘fuel’ until their evening meal. But that first breakfast – which ideally will be rich in protein and fibre – sets the body up for the day, re-charging the brain so that it operates more efficiently, and giving the body the necessary nutrients for it also to operate with ease.

It is for these reasons that national experts refer to breakfast as the most important meal of the day. And, as with many other things, eating habits are generally learned early in life and carried through lifetimes, so the importance of educating our children as to the importance of this meal cannot be overstated. And, in particular, because as school children when they are learning and growing more intensively than at any other time in their life, breakfast will assist them with their studies. Poor academic performance together with decreased school attendance, displeasure in school and poor lecture learning have been linked to fatigue which is measured in studies using the Chalder Fatigue Scale which has been shown to be reliable in evaluating the severity of fatigue. And in the magazine ‘Nutrition’, recently a study in Japan was published which showed that skipping breakfast was associated with fatigue in medical students. So, as I have said, it is important that we assist our children to learn good eating habits early in life which will alleviate other problems and challenges for them as they get older and begin to demand more of their bodies and minds!

There are many studies which confirm that breakfast is an important meal which should be included in our daily routine, but one which I will mention here is The Third National Health and Nutrition Examination Survey (NHANES III) which investigated the relationship between BMI and breakfast consumption by looking at the relationship between breakfast type, total daily energy intake, and BMI. The survey addressed 16,452 adults in a large, population based study that confirmed there was no correlation between skipping breakfast and losing weight – not eating breakfast is not a successful weight loss technique! This study also noted that breakfast choice plays a role in lowering BMI. Individuals that ate cereal (hot or cold) or quick breads for breakfast as opposed to meat and eggs had a significantly lower BMI. So, once again, it is true to say that it is not necessary to spend a lot of time preparing a ‘meal’ for breakfast. Something quick, like cereal and a splash of milk, will not take time to prepare, but will be beneficial in health terms.

New Study: Your Hips Handle Walking, While Ankles Attend to Running

In a study this spring, researchers at North Carolina State University concluded that the hips generate more of the power when people walk, but the ankles carry the burden when humans run, while knees provide approximately one-fifth or less of walking or running power. NC State biomedical engineers Drs. Dominic Farris and Gregory Sawicki were co-authors of a study on the mechanics of walking and running that was published in Interface, a Royal Society scientific journal.

Sawicki says that this study shows that the hips generate 44 percent of the power when people walk at a rate of 2 meters per second, with ankles contributing 39 percent of the power.

When people start running at a 2-meter-per-second rate, the ankles provide 47 percent of the power compared to 32 percent for the hips. Ankles continue to provide the most power of the three lower limb joints as running speeds increase, although the hips begin closing the distance at faster speeds.

Researchers are interested in how the study can help people who need assistance walking and running. Knowing which part of the lower limbs provide more power during the different activities can help engineers figure out how, depending on the person’s speed and gait, mechanical power needs to be distributed.

Farris says: “For example, devices such as an exoskeleton or prosthesis may have motors near both the hip and ankle. If a person will be walking and then running, you’d need to redistribute energy from the hip to the ankle when the person makes that transition.”

In the study, ten people walked and ran at various speeds on a specially designed treadmill in the study. Cameras captured their gait by tracking reflective markers attached to various parts of the participants’ lower limbs while the treadmill captured data from the applied force.

The study examined walking and running on level ground in order to gauge the differences brought about by increased speed. Walking and running on inclined ground is different than walking and running on flat ground, the researchers say, and would likely skew the power generation results toward the hips and knees.

Medicaid Braces Are a Boon to Lower Income Families

Families with low income have a greater chance of having a diet that is far from nutritionally sound. With less access to funds they have to rely on the small amounts of food they can afford or worse, fast food. Without a proper variety of food in their lives, their entire immune system will undoubtedly be negatively affected. This is, of course, tied in with the health of their teeth. If someone is only subsisting on cheap burgers and fries and soda on a daily basis with only a smidgen of nutritional view, their ignoring of other essential vitamins only works against them. Thankfully however, many of poor families have access to federal and/or state-funded assistance and programs. One such program is Medicaid, which is a health program for those with little to no resources for medical care. Using this program, low-income families can afford Medicaid braces and other dental services from NY orthodontists.

It is very important to take care of your teeth. To have unhealthy teeth will negatively impact your eating habits. One of the benefits of Medicaid braces to low-income families is that it can help correct crooked teeth. Having misaligned teeth means the chewing process won’t be at its best and makes cleaning them that much more difficult. Since it is harder to clean crooked teeth, there is an increased risk of tooth decay, cavities, and even gingivitis. Also, having bad teeth will impair the proper chewing of food which will lead to digestive problems. Pain from biting is also a common problem with having crooked teeth.

Another dental issue that can be fixed by orthodontists are over bites. This is characterized by having the upper jaw extend the teeth further out than the bottom half. Under bites are the other way around but is much rarer. Either of these things are bad and can cause strain to the jaw and muscles. It also increases the risk of breaking a tooth. Another problem stemming from over/under bites is that either can cause tooth enamel to wear down, increasing the chance of teeth breaking.

Orthodontists can provide poor families with the proper care they need to take care of whatever dental issues they may have. These specialists can also provide information on what they should be eating and how to maintain healthy teeth. With Medicaid assistance, low-income individuals can devote extra resources to providing themselves with a healthier diet.

Subacromial Decompression Surgery – Don’t Worry About It

By Nick Browning

Having recently undergone surgery for a shoulder impingement I decided to write about how things went in order to help ease any worries of anyone who is anticipating such an operation

An impinged shoulder can begin for a number of different reasons and the treatment will vary depending on the cause.

Within the shoulder there is a narrow channel, called the subacromial space, which runs between the head of the humerus (upper arm bone) and a part of the shoulder blade known as the acromion

Through this channel run the tendons of the supraspinatus muscle. This is one of the rotator cuff muscles, a group of four muscles which pull the arm into the shoulder joint, stabilizing the joint and also helping with arm rotation.

Normally the tendon slides back and forth through the subacromial space without any problems. When you suffer from impingement syndrome the channel gets restricted making it too small to take the tendon, resulting in pinching or an impingement of the tendon as we move our arm.

This could be caused by an injury to the tendon that causes the tendon to become inflamed, it might be due to changes in posture brought about by age or even caused by by bone spurs growing underneath the acromion, effectively shrinking the space available for the tendon.

Whatever the cause, it is a very painful condition that will simply deteriorate as time goes by. The pinching causes wear, which in turn causes inflammation, worsening the impingement. A vicious circle of pain and inflammation with the shoulder getting more painful and weaker with each passing day.

There are a number of conservative treatments for shoulder impingement which are usually tried before using surgery. The majority of rotator cuff impingements can be significantly improved or even cured completely without surgical intervention.

In my case I had tried rest, physiotherapy, steroid injections and anti-inflammatory drugs without any success, so surgery was eventually recommended.

My surgery day arrived and I checked in at my local hospital one morning. The surgeon explained that the whole procedure would be over in around an hour. He would make two or three small cuts each side of my shoulder. an Athroscope would then be inserted into the incisions to inspect the shoulder joint and confirm what needed doing.

The surgeon would then cut off a small piece of bone from the underneath of the acromion to increase the size of teh channel and release the impingement. While he was in there, he would check out the joint and carry out any minor repairs at the same time. It all sounded very simple…..and it was. The surgery went well. Just over an hour after going under the anaesthetic I woke up to find my wife seated at my bedside reading a newspaper, feigning indifference.

A while later the surgeon called in to say that he had made three incisions. The first two were for the normal operation, and one extra in order to repair my labrum which was slightly frayed. Providing that I had recovered from the anaesthetic, I could go home later that day.

I was given a sling for the first couple of days but it was explained that I needed to keep my arm as mobile as possible. I was also given some simple exercises to do after the weekend. I was booked in to see a physiotherapist a few days later

That first night at home was difficult because my shoulder was still sore and bruised from the surgery but I had been given some painkillers which helped with the pain and let me get a good night’s sleep.

Surprisingly, I was able to return to work the following Monday without any problem and managing to use my arm reasonably normally. My shoulder joint, which had hurt for several months, was much better. The impingement no longer hurt. I started physiotherapy that week and within six weeks felt that my shoulder was back to normal.

My recovery was much quicker than normal. Recovery from this operation usually takes between two and six months. How well you carry out your exercise regime will have a dramatic impact on how long it takes to get better. Physiotherapy is normally aimed at restoring the strength of therotator cuff muscles. It will start with gentle passive exercises to maintain shoulder mobility, and then gradually increase resistance to strengthen the muscles.

This type of surgery is successful in relieving pain and improving shoulder mobility in over ninety percent of cases. If it is suggested to you as a possible treatment for rotator cuff impingement, grab it with your one good arm.
